God Is Close to the Brokenhearted: Finding Hope in Pain and Divine Presence
God Is Close to the Brokenhearted: Finding Hope in Pain and Divine Presence
When life pushes us to the very edges of sorrow, doubt creeps in. Where does God stand in the face of deep pain? In moments of heartbreak, loss, or despair, many ask: Is God near when I’m broken? The profound truth—“God is close to the brokenhearted”—offers more than comfort; it reveals the heart of divine love and unwavering presence.
Why God Is Closer When You’re Brokenhearted
Understanding the Context
The Bible repeatedly assures us that God does not abandon pain but walks with it. Psalm 34:18 declares, “The Lord is close to the brokenhearted and saves the wounded heart.” This isn’t merely a poetic phrase—it’s a divine promise. When our spirits are shattered by grief, betrayal, or heartache, God’s nearness transforms isolation into connection.
Brokenheartedness strips away pretenses, revealing raw vulnerability—a space where genuine intimacy with the Divine becomes possible. Rather than distant or indifferent, God steps into the outpouring of sorrow, offering not just pity but purposeful presence.
Healing Begins When We Acknowledge Our Brokenness
The journey from heartbreak to hope starts with honest acceptance. Many struggle with feeling unworthy of comfort or fear burdening God. Yet Scripture reminds us that raw honesty brings clarity. Lamentations 3:19–21 says, “Because of the Lord’s great love we are not consumed… He reminds us of our humble states, but in His mercy, we find healing.”
Key Insights
Recognizing your brokenness before God creates space for grace. It’s not about remaining stuck in pain but entering into a sacred relationship where God meets sorrow with compassion. He doesn’t demand strength—He meets weakness and repairs it.
God’s Presence in the Middle of Lament
True spiritual courage lies in bringing your full emotional truth to God—tears, anger, confusion, and silent desperation. In Isaiah 41:10, God reassures, “Do not fear, for I am with you; do not tremble, for I am your God. I will strengthen you and help you; I will uphold you with My righteous right hand.”
This is not a general encouragement—it is a declaration specifically for those walking through brokenness. God’s promise underscores His intimate awareness of pain and His determined presence within it.

God is not a distant observer. Through Scripture, prayer, worship, and sacred community, believers are invited into a living relationship. When hearts are broken, prayer becomes a lifeline—an honest conversation where souls lay bare their fears and wounds.
Chapters like Lamentations and Psalms echo with raw honesty, showing how God invites lament without judgment and narrative healing through grace. This kind of relationship turns brokenness into a vessel through which deeper faith and understanding grow.
Living Out the Truth: God’s Proximity Is Reality, Not Illusion
Believers are called not just to feel comforted but to live in the reality of God’s nearness. This means trusting that healing takes time, carrying pain with courage, and knowing that no amount of sorrow defines the ultimate story. God is not just close—He is close enough to meet us in every fragment of our broken humanity.
Conclusion
When grief breaks your heart, remember: God is near to the brokenhearted. In momentous times, this truth transforms despair into hope, isolation into connection, and pain into purpose. Open your soul to the boundless, tender presence of a God who walks with you—heart to broken heart—and restores you from within.
